“There’s no doubt that the multi-instrumentalist (and singer) from Macedonia (who lives in New York) is making the most of his abundant talents. “Let Us Be” is an 8-part ode to joy, so to speak. Cetkar, a master of the good groove since 2009, pulls out all the soul-funk-jazz stops here, skimping on catchy hooks and easy-rolling beats. True to his trademark style, strings and horns are showcased to perfection at every turn, fulfilling our every wish.

Joerg Schmitt
(Sonic Soul, Germany)

“Vladimir is not your usual 21st century musician who cannot do much without a computer, he does everything by writing notes on paper like the classical musicians of days gone by. I saw him composing and arranging a very sophisticated song by humming it, and writing it at the same time on a piece of paper, ready for an orchestra to play it!
That was something I will never forget.

Dimitri From Paris
(World renowned DJ, producer and composer who played a pivotal role in elevating the French house music scene, taking it from relative obscurity to global recognition.)
